본문 바로가기

Python

[Python] 문자 삭제 함수 strip

1. lstrip()

문자열에서 왼쪽에 있는 연속된 모든 공백을 삭제한다.

l은 왼쪽(left)를 의미한다.

>>> '   Python   '.lstrip()
'Python   '
 

2. rstrip()

문자열에서 오른쪽에 있는 연속된 모든 공백을 삭제한다.

r은 오른쪽(right)를 의미한다.

>>> '   Python   '.rstrip()
'   Python'
 

3. strip()

문자열에서 양쪽에 있는 연속된 공백을 삭제한다.

>>> '   Python   '.strip()
'Python'
 

4. lstrip('삭제할문자들')

삭제할 문자들을 문자열 형태로 넣어주면 문자열 왼쪽에 있는 해당 문자를 삭제한다.

>>> ', python.'.lstrip(',.')
' python.'
 

5. rstrip('삭제할문자들')

삭제할 문자들을 문자열 형태로 넣어주면 문자열 오른쪽에 있는 해당 문자를 삭제한다.

>>> ', python.'.rstrip(',.')
', python'
 

6. strip()

삭제할 문자들을 문자열 형태로 넣어주면 문자열 양쪽에 있는 해당 문자를 삭제한다.

>>> ', python.'.strip(',.')
' python'
 

 

참고: 파이썬 코딩 도장, dojang.io/mod/page/view.php?id=2299